3.3 I Installing the sensors on the POD kit

• Screw down the one or more sensor holders onto the POD kit, see illustrati on
• Carefully unscrew the protecti on tube from the sensor, see illustrati on
use when the sensor is stored during the winter.
• Rinse the end of the sensor with tap water and shake off excess water, see illustrati on
• Never wipe the sensor using a cloth or paper ti ssue, as this may damage it!
• A badly-installed sensor may give false readings and cause inappropriate operati on of the
appliance. Neither the manufacturer nor the appliance shall be liable in this event.
• Screw the sensor into the sensor holder, holding the BLUE or YELLOW connector in one hand and the black
connector in the other to avoid tangling the cable, see illustrati on
• Once the sensor is installed on the POD kit, it can be connected to the BNC connector (BLUE = pH; YELLOW
= ORP) on the pH Link or Dual Link module, see "2.5.3 Electrical connecti on steps", see illustrati on
• Then the sensor is ready for calibrati on, see "5.3 I Calibrati ng the sensors (if an opti onal pH Link or Dual
Link module is installed)"
